Scaling AI Knowledge Bases: Open-Source vs. Proprietary Tools

Written by:

Scaling AI Knowledge Bases: Open-Source vs. Proprietary Tools

Scaling an AI knowledge base comes down to a key decision: open-source tools or proprietary platforms. Each option has its strengths and weaknesses, and the right choice depends on your organization’s needs, budget, and technical expertise.

Key Takeaways:

  • Open-Source Tools: Offer full customization, flexibility, and control but require technical expertise for setup, scaling, and maintenance.
  • Proprietary Tools: Provide ready-to-use platforms with built-in features, vendor support, and predictable costs, making them easier for non-technical teams.

Before diving deeper into the specifics, let’s look at a quick comparison of the key features of open-source and proprietary AI tools.

Quick Comparison:

FeatureOpen-Source ToolsProprietary Tools
CustomizationFull code access, unlimited modificationsLimited to platform-provided options
Setup TimeWeeks to monthsHours to days
CostFree software, but high infrastructure and staffing costsFixed subscription fees, all-inclusive
Technical RequirementsRequires skilled developersDesigned for non-technical users
ScalingManual resource allocationAutomated scaling
SecuritySelf-managedVendor-managed

If you need flexibility and have the technical resources, open-source tools may be your best bet. For ease of use, faster deployment, and built-in support, proprietary platforms like Magai can simplify scaling and management.

programmer working on open-source code on one side and  business team using a proprietary platform on the other

Core Features: Open-Source vs. Proprietary Tools

When scaling an AI knowledge base, understanding the core features of open-source and proprietary tools is essential. Open-source tools offer flexibility and control, while proprietary solutions provide ease of use and ready-to-go features, each catering to different organizational needs.

Open-Source Tool Features

Open-source AI knowledge base tools provide extensive customization options, giving users full control over the code to meet specific needs. These tools emphasize flexibility with features like:

  • Community Contributions: Improved by a global network of developers.
  • Customizable Architecture: Modify and expand core functionalities as needed.
  • Direct Database Management: Full control over database structures for optimization.
  • Custom APIs: Seamless integration with existing systems.

While offering unparalleled control, these tools require dedicated teams for setup, ongoing maintenance, security, and performance tuning, especially for larger-scale operations.

Proprietary tools, on the other hand, focus on ease of use and ready-to-go functionality.

Proprietary Tool Features

Proprietary platforms are designed to simplify AI knowledge base management with user-friendly features such as:

  • Collaboration Tools: Built-in options for sharing AI content across teams.
  • Automated Organization: Smart systems for sorting and managing files.
  • Version Tracking: Automatic logging of edits and updates.
  • Vendor Support: Access to professional assistance and regular updates.

“Magai makes EVERY ASPECT of my business easier. I have 10x my production rate and couldn’t be happier, but possibly the biggest plus is that support is personal, fast, and generous with their solutions and answers.” – Paige Bliss

These platforms enable teams to:

  • Set up separate workspaces for projects.
  • Share AI-generated content across departments effortlessly.
  • Collaborate in real time within a unified interface.
  • Keep AI-related files neatly organized in folders.

“I appreciate having access to multiple LLMs, and the ability to create personas, prompts, and chats, as well as organize them, is game-changing.” – Donna

Here’s a quick comparison of the two approaches:

Feature CategoryOpen-Source ToolsProprietary Tools
CustomizationFull code access and modificationLimited to platform-provided options
Technical RequirementsHigh – requires development expertiseLow – designed for non-technical users
Support SystemCommunity forums and documentationProfessional vendor support
Implementation TimeWeeks to monthsHours to days
Feature UpdatesSelf-implemented or community-drivenRegular vendor releases
Integration OptionsUnlimited but requires developmentPre-built connectors with popular tools

Understanding these differences is crucial for choosing the right tool to effectively scale your AI knowledge base.

an accountant focusing on open-source budget data analysis on a large computer screen to the left and examining proprietary platform costs with detailed financial reports and subscription invoices on another large screen

Cost Analysis

Analyzing the costs of open-source versus proprietary AI tools is crucial for selecting the right solution. Open-source tools may start with free software but can incur high technical expenses, while proprietary options provide predictable pricing with subscription models.

Open-Source Expenses

While open-source tools themselves are free, they come with additional costs. These include infrastructure expenses like server hosting, databases, backups, and content delivery networks, as well as hiring specialized staff such as DevOps engineers, database administrators, and security experts. As the AI knowledge base grows, these expenses can climb quickly. Proprietary tools, on the other hand, simplify cost management by bundling these elements into a fixed subscription fee.

Proprietary Expenses

Proprietary solutions operate on subscription models that include infrastructure, security, and maintenance costs. This eliminates the need for separate capital investments and reduces technical complexity. For example, Magai starts at $19/month for basic use, with higher-tier plans offering team collaboration and advanced features. This setup makes budgeting and scaling much easier.

Cost FactorOpen-SourceProprietary
Initial SetupHigher upfront investment for setup and integrationMinimal setup costs with ready-to-use solutions
Monthly CostsVariable costs for hosting, maintenance, and infrastructureFixed subscription fee covering all essentials
Staff RequirementsDedicated technical team needed for managementLower IT burden with built-in professional support
ScalingCosts grow significantly with system expansionTiered pricing ensures predictable scaling
SupportSelf-managed or requires third-party servicesSupport included in the subscription fee

After exploring cost factors, let’s shift our focus to how these tools handle growth and performance challenges.

a diverse team of professionals attentively observing a performance graph

Growth and Performance

Growth and performance are vital when choosing between open-source and proprietary AI tools. While open-source tools may face scaling challenges, proprietary platforms often streamline growth with built-in features and automated resources.

Challenges with Open-Source Tools

Open-source AI tools often struggle to scale effectively as usage grows. Managing resources and optimizing systems can become increasingly difficult, especially as data volumes rise. This often forces organizations to upgrade their infrastructure repeatedly, adding more layers of complexity. Meanwhile, proprietary solutions often sidestep these issues by using automated resource scaling.

Advantages of Proprietary Solutions

Proprietary tools come equipped with features that handle growth seamlessly. For example, Magai’s cloud-based infrastructure adjusts automatically to meet increased demand. Its integrated workspaces make it easier for organizations to handle expanding teams and projects. Tools like chat folders and saved prompts ensure smooth performance, even as usage scales up.

“Magai offers complete variety of the latest LLMs at your fingertips in one thoughtfully designed and responsive chat interface. It has constantly improved ever since I’ve been a user, making it an easy choice when it comes to the competition. It’s a tool that you can count on keeping up with the latest cutting edge models without having to create a feature request.” – Steven Aaron

IT security team analyzing data on multiple screens displaying open-source and proprietary tool security checks

Security Standards

Security is a major concern when selecting AI tools. Open-source options require users to manage their security, while proprietary platforms offer built-in protection to keep your data safe.

Open-Source Security

Open-source AI tools provide transparency by making their code publicly available, allowing organizations to perform security audits. However, this openness can also reveal potential weaknesses. With self-hosted solutions, businesses take on the responsibility for critical security measures like infrastructure management, data encryption, compliance, and monitoring for vulnerabilities. On the other hand, proprietary platforms often take care of these security aspects entirely, reducing the burden on organizations.

Proprietary Security

Proprietary platforms handle security by securely storing user chats on their servers, ensuring they remain accessible even during outages. For example, Magai allows teams to add members and share AI-generated content with ease. By managing security, these platforms let organizations concentrate on their main objectives while ensuring sensitive data and scaling needs are protected.

Modular Solutions for Knowledge Management at scale in …

Feature Comparison Table

Here’s a side-by-side look at key features of open-source and proprietary AI knowledge bases:

Feature CategoryOpen-Source ToolsProprietary Tools
Initial Setup CostsRequires investment in server infrastructure, development team, and setup timeSubscription-based pricing with minimal setup and quick deployment
Ongoing ExpensesIncludes infrastructure maintenance, security updates, and development resourcesPredictable monthly or annual fees with maintenance and updates included
CustomizationAllows full code access, unlimited modifications, and custom integrationsOffers pre-built features, limited customization, and API access
Scaling CapabilitiesRelies on manual resource allocation and team-managed growthProvides automatic scaling with usage-based resources and managed growth
Security FeaturesRequires self-managed encryption, custom protocols, and compliance measuresIncludes built-in encryption, automated backups, and compliance certifications
Support ServicesOffers community forums, documentation, and self-managed troubleshootingFeatures 24/7 dedicated support and regular training
Team CollaborationInvolves custom workflows, manual user management, and self-hosted sharingIncludes built-in workspaces, user role management, and integrated sharing
Resource ManagementRequires manual monitoring and custom usage trackingProvides automated monitoring, usage analytics, and flexible resource limits

This table highlights the key operational differences between the two options. For example, Magai’s Professional plan costs $29 per month and includes 20 workspaces, 5-user support, and a capacity of 200,000 words. This offers predictable scaling without the need for managing infrastructure.

“Finally an aggregator that has a proper memory function so that you’re not always having to repeat or re-explain yourself. It has so many tools to use and I love having them all within 1 platform.” – G2 Reviewer, Small-Business

These distinctions help organizations select the solution that matches their growth plans and resource needs.

Conclusion

The choice between open-source flexibility and proprietary efficiency plays a key role in scaling AI knowledge bases. Open-source options allow for limitless customization but require technical know-how and ongoing maintenance. On the other hand, proprietary platforms offer a more managed, user-friendly approach with predictable scaling. Let’s break down these trade-offs, focusing on integration, security, and cost.

For organizations looking for a unified AI solution, proprietary platforms shine with their seamless integration. These platforms combine high-quality AI models with built-in security and collaboration tools – features that would take significant effort to replicate in open-source setups.

“Imagine if all the top generative AI tools were packaged in one place, with an easy-to-use interface, to save time and minimize frustration? That’s Magai. Instantly indispensable!” – Jay Baer, Author, Keynote Speaker

In addition to integration, proprietary platforms stand out for their strong security measures and simplified team collaboration. They provide enterprise-level protection while making workflows easier through centralized interfaces.

Ultimately, the decision comes down to your organization’s technical expertise, budget, and growth goals. Whether you choose the customization of open-source tools or the convenience of proprietary platforms, the solution should support your long-term growth while keeping security and efficiency in check.

Latest Articles